What is Basketball Hit?

Basketball Hit combines basketball mechanics with distance-based throwing gameplay. Your mission isn't to win a standard basketball match; instead, each round is an attempt to launch the ball with enough force and momentum to cover the greatest possible distance.

The game relies on timing and physics to make every throw unique. A well-timed throw can send the ball much further, whereas poor timing can cause it to lose momentum quickly. As you progress, increasing distances and unique environments make each throw more challenging.

How to Play Basketball Hit

Master the Power Meter

One of the most critical elements of Basketball Hit is timing your throw. The game features a continuously moving power meter, and you must stop it at the right moment to generate a powerful shot.

The green zone is usually the ideal target. Precise timing provides the ball with greater initial force, helping it travel further.

Observe the Ball's Movement

Once launched, the ball's movement is governed by physics. It can bounce, roll, and continue moving across the environment. Instead of trying to execute the perfect throw immediately, pay attention to how the ball behaves after different types of throws.

Understanding how much momentum you can generate is key to improving your distance results.

Tips and Tricks for Basketball Hit

Perfect Your Timing

The most important skill early on is getting a feel for the rhythm of the power meter. Don't just click as fast as possible; watch the meter closely and practice your timing to ensure precision. Prioritize useful upgrades

Focus on upgrades that directly improve the ball's flight distance. Stronger throws and better bounce capabilities will help you make significant strides.

Learn from every attempt

Even an unsuccessful throw offers value. Pay attention to your timing, the power of the throw, and the point where the ball begins to lose momentum. Even minor adjustments can lead to much better results.

Beat your own record

Instead of stressing over achieving a massive distance right away, aim to surpass your previous best. This approach turns each attempt into a mini-challenge, making the journey of improvement more enjoyable and rewarding.
